This Saturday, a highly anticipated clash will headline the men`s Round of 12 at the Joao Pessoa Elite16 on the Volleyball World Beach Pro Tour. The world`s top-ranked and highly experienced Norwegian duo, Anders Mol & Christian Sorum, are set to face the promising young Swedish team of Jacob Holting Nilsson & Elmer Andersson, currently ranked fourth globally.
French Teams Ignite Tournament with Major Upsets
In a surprising turn of events, Argentina’s Nicolas Capogrosso & Tomas Capogrosso, the world`s third-ranked team, were eliminated in Friday’s Round of 18. French qualifiers Remi Bassereau & Calvin Aye, seeded 21st in the main draw, achieved a decisive 2-0 (21-17, 21-17) victory over the 15th-seeded Argentinians. Bassereau was a key performer, delivering a match-high 20 points, which included an impressive seven kill blocks and an ace. Following this remarkable win, Bassereau & Aye will now challenge the second-seeded Dutch pair, Stefan Boermans & Yorick de Groot, who emerged as Pool B winners.
Mol & Sorum Bounce Back with Strong Performance
After an unexpected third-place finish in their pool, top-seeded Mol & Sorum have found their stride. They secured a hard-fought 2-0 (23-21, 21-17) win against Germany’s Lukas Pfretzschner & Sven Winter in their initial knockout match. This victory sets the stage for their exciting encounter with the fourth-seeded Swedish youngsters Holting Nilsson & Andersson. Christian Sorum was the top scorer for his team, amassing 19 points purely from powerful offensive swings.
Overview of Other Key Round of 12 Matchups
- Another French team, Teo Rotar & Arnaud Gauthier-Rat, advanced to the Round of 12 by defeating American Olympians Miles Evans & Chase Budinger 2-0 (21-15, 23-21). They are slated to challenge the eighth-seeded Dutch duo, Steven van de Velde & Alexander Brouwer, who won Pool E.
- Two of the three host country teams survived the first elimination round. Brazilian qualifiers Vinicius Freitas & Heitor Barbosa were granted a forfeit victory after their Polish opponents Michal Bryl & Bartosz Losiak withdrew due to injury. This sets up an all-Brazilian Round of 12 contest against compatriots George Wanderley & Saymon Barbosa.
- Sixth-seeded Brazilians Evandro Oliveira & Arthur Mariano Lanci, who finished sixth in Pool F, progressed to the Round of 12 with a 2-0 (22-20, 21-11) win over Norway’s Mathias Berntsen & Hendrik Mol. Their next challenge will be the 24th-seeded Portuguese qualifiers, Joao Pedrosa & Hugo Campos.
- Reigning Olympic champions David Ahman & Jonatan Hellvig of Sweden, seeded fourth, recovered from their earlier pool play loss to George & Saymon. They delivered a commanding 2-0 (21-14, 21-16) shutout against Brazilian qualifiers Andre Stein & Renato Lima. The Swedish jump-setters will now face the undefeated Austrian qualifiers Timo Hammarberg & Tim Berger.
Saturday`s men`s competition in Joao Pessoa promises a full day of thrilling beach volleyball, with matches for both the Round of 12 and the quarterfinals scheduled to commence at 09:00 local time (12:00 UTC).
